Solution Overview

Problem

There is no information on printed matter indicating the location of the web page where an image was published, making it difficult for users to identify the original web page after printing.

Innovation Solution

A printing control device and method that includes a specification receiving unit to select images, an image acquisition unit to acquire images, an access information acquisition unit to get access information, a code information creation unit to create code information, and a printing execution unit to print the image and code information together, allowing users to easily identify the web page by reading the code.

Engineering Contradictions & Design Principles

VSEngineering Contradiction Analysis

1Ease of manufacture

If code information is printed on paper that bleeds easily, then the printing process is simple, but the readability of the code information deteriorates

Engineering Contradiction:
Improveprinting process simplicityVSAvoidcode information readability
Core Design Contradiction:
Ease of manufactureVSMeasurement precision

Solution Approach 1:

The patent applies local quality by adjusting the ink density specifically for the code information area based on paper type. For papers prone to bleeding, the ink density is reduced only in the code information region, while other areas may maintain normal density. This localized adjustment prevents code smearing while preserving overall print quality.

Inventive Principle:
Principle #3Local quality

Solution Approach 2:

The patent changes the ink density parameter dynamically based on the detected paper type. When bleeding-prone paper is detected, the system automatically reduces the ink density for code information printing. This parameter adjustment resolves the contradiction by adapting the printing process to the specific paper characteristics.

Inventive Principle:
Principle #35Parameter changes

Data Source

PatentUS9167127B2Printing control device, program, and printing method
Publication Date: 2015.10.20 SEIKO EPSON CORP

AI summary

A printing control device, a program, and a printing method is provided for creating printed matter for which a user can easily identify a web page on which an image included in the printed matter is published. A printing control device accessible to a server for managing a web site through a network includes a specification receiving unit receiving specification of an image published on the web site, an image acquisition unit acquiring the specified image through the server, an access information acquisition unit acquiring access information for accessing a web page on which the image is published on the web site, a code information creation unit creating code information expressing the access information using text or an image, and a printing execution unit making a printer print a synthetic image in which the acquired image and the created code information are included.
